The foundation of any great pre-K program, whether in a larger center or a smaller home-based setting, is a focus on social-emotional learning. In a community like ours, where children often grow up knowing everyone, a good program will help them learn to share, take turns, express their feelings with words, and navigate friendships. These are the skills that create confident and kind neighbors and classmates. Look for a program where the teachers speak warmly about helping children manage big emotions and solve problems together, as this is the cornerstone of a positive early experience.
Academics in pre-K should feel like play, because for young children, that’s exactly what learning is. The best programs here in Ryegate will weave early literacy and math concepts into daily activities. This might mean counting rocks collected on a nature walk, hearing stories read aloud with great expression, or recognizing letters in their own name. The goal isn’t to pressure children but to spark their natural curiosity. When you visit a potential program, listen for the sound of engaged chatter and happy play, and look for classrooms rich with books, art supplies, and imaginative play areas.

Your search likely involves practical considerations, too. Visiting any potential program is the most important step. Schedule a time to observe. Watch how the teachers interact with the children—are they down on the floor engaging, or distant? Trust your instincts as a parent; you know your child best. Talk to other Ryegate parents for their personal experiences and recommendations. Remember, the right fit is a place where your child feels safe, loved, and excited to explore.
